Herford Station is part of the Gutersloh Garrison Barracks. It comprises of Harewood, Hammersmith & Wentworth camps which are all located around the town centre. Herford was once a thriving walled market town and traces of the original wall can still be seen along the rivers Aa and Werre. 
Today Herford town has a number of streets of old fashioned houses, which now accommodate modern shops and a number of very good restaurants bare witness to the town’s 1200 years of history. It is also famous for its many factories and workshops plus the ‘Herforder Brewery' and the MARTa modern art Museum.
The town’s close proximity to the A2 autobahn also allows access to many other parts of Germany and the Teutoburger Wald region with its host of outdoor attractions, woodland and walking areas.

For new arrivals the Welfare Centre on Hammersmith Barracks should be your first port of call when arriving in station. Tel: 0049 (0) 5221 995 3353
All family documentation is completed here and includes the issue of Naafi shopping permits, Dependant ID cards, application for school children's visits and most other administrative tasks. Anyone with a Vehicle and new into the Station should visit the BFG office in the Bradley Centre on Hammersmith Barracks upon arrival to start the vehicle registration process. Contact: 0049 (0) 5221 995 3355.
The primary school for Herford is on Wentworth Barracks, Lister school . The secondary school, Prince Rupert is a 30-minute bus ride away at Rinteln.
Herford Station has many amenities; these include a Medical & Dental Centre (MRS), Naafi, SSVC, hair and beauty salon, travel agents, a well-stocked PRI shop, Riding School, Gym, Cinema plus much, much more.
